SBS News in Filipino, Tuesday 27 January 2026

 A ferry with more than 340 people onboard sank early Monday off the southern Philippines

Survivors of the sunken passenger vessel M/V Trisha Kerstin 3 were brought to Isabela City, Basilan for assistance and assessment.. Image: CIO City Government of Isabela de Basilan

Here are today's top stories on SBS Filipino.


Key Points
  • An extreme heatwave continues to affect South Australia, Victoria, and NSW with authorities on alert over the bushfire threat.
  • Isang pampasaherong barko ang lumubog sa Basilan, kung saan mahigit 18 na ang kumpirmadong nasawi.
  • At least 18 dead after ferry with over 340 onboard sinks off southern Philippines.
